How can businesses improve voice search optimization for higher rankings in 2024?

Structured Summary

  1. Understand user intent and behavior
  2. Optimize for conversational language
  3. Focus on local SEO
  4. Improve website speed and mobile-friendliness
  5. Create high-quality, relevant content

Understanding User Intent and Behavior

To improve voice search optimization, businesses need to understand the specific queries and intents of their target audience. This involves conducting thorough keyword research and analyzing the types of questions users are asking through voice search.

Optimizing for Conversational Language

Voice search queries are often more conversational in nature compared to traditional text-based searches. Businesses should optimize their content to match the natural language used in voice searches, including long-tail keywords and question-based phrases.

Focusing on Local SEO

Since many voice searches are location-based, businesses should prioritize local SEO efforts to ensure their content is optimized for local queries. This includes claiming and optimizing Google My Business listings, using location-specific keywords, and creating locally relevant content.

Improving Website Speed and Mobile-Friendliness

Fast-loading, mobile-friendly websites are essential for voice search optimization. Businesses should prioritize website speed and mobile responsiveness to provide a seamless user experience for voice search users.

Creating High-Quality, Relevant Content

High-quality, relevant content that directly addresses user queries is crucial for voice search optimization. Businesses should focus on creating comprehensive, authoritative content that answers common voice search questions within their industry or niche.
